Introduction

Each year since 1997, the Federal Interagency Forum on Child and Family Statistics has published a report on the well-being of children and families.

Pending data availability, the Forum updates all 40 indicators annually on its Web site (http://childstats.gov) and alternates publishing a detailed report, America’s Children: Key National Indicators of Well-Being, with a summary version that highlights selected indicators.

QPR (Question, Persuade, Respond) is a suicide prevention technique for anyone who might be in a position to intervene and be a first responder in preventing a suicide (pretty much everybody).  It is being developed for use in online communications. 

The QPR Institute launched the Online Suicide Intervention Specialist training program.

The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services has established a Pre-Existing Condition Insurance Plan (PCIP) for uninsured Americans who have been unable to obtain health coverage because of a pre-existing health condition. This plan may benefit families whose insurance options are limited or non-existent because of their child’s special health needs.

Poverty at Birth is Associated With Poverty at Later Points in Life

Forty-nine percent of babies born to poor families will be poor for half their childhood in contrast with four percent of babies born to families that are not poor.
